Hosts Kevin Flynn and Alex Taylor kick off the show on a high note, celebrating a weekend of gorgeous, unseasonably warm weather with highs predicted to reach 87 degrees on Monday. They also discuss a major news story: the indictment of former FBI director James Comey on charges of making false statements and obstruction of a congressional proceeding. The hosts play and react to Comey’s public statement, in which he portrays himself as a martyr standing up to Donald Trump. They also feature commentary from legal experts who believe the indictment is long overdue and a necessary step toward accountability.

In other segments, they cover a variety of topics, including the new president and CEO of the Fargo-Moorhead Convention and Visitors Bureau, Shirley Hughes, who shares her vision for the community and provides an update on the city’s convention center project. Agricultural Director Bridgette Readel joins the show to discuss the persistence of Asian beetles and a new online mental health tool for farmers. The show also touches on local sports, the history of Johnny Appleseed, and a surprising number of texts from listeners, one of whom suggests that western Minnesota should secede and join North Dakota.
